在數字化浪潮中,雲伺服器已成為企業和開發者構建應用的核心基礎設施。它提供了彈性、可擴充套件的計算資源,徹底改變了傳統IT部署模式。理解雲伺服器的全生命週期管理,從初始選擇到日常運維,對於最佳化成本、保障效能與安全至關重要。本文將系統性地解析雲伺服器的關鍵環節,助您做出明智決策並建立高效運維體系。
雲伺服器核心概念與優勢解析
雲伺服器,本質上是透過虛擬化技術在大型物理伺服器叢集上劃分出的、具有獨立作業系統和資源配置的計算例項。使用者可以透過網路遠端訪問和管理,按需獲取計算、儲存和網路能力。
虛擬化技術的基石
雲服務的底層依賴於成熟的虛擬化技術,如KVM、Xen、VMware等。這些技術將物理硬體資源抽象化、池化,並動態分配給多個虛擬機器例項。這使得單一物理伺服器能夠同時執行多個相互隔離的雲伺服器,極大提升了硬體利用率和部署靈活性。
推薦閱讀 雲伺服器終極指南:從新手到專家的完整選擇與配置教程。
相較於傳統伺服器的核心優勢
與傳統物理伺服器或VPS相比,雲伺服器具備顯著優勢。其彈性伸縮特性允許使用者根據業務流量實時調整資源配置,無需擔心硬體採購和上架週期。它具備高可用性,通常建立在分散式叢集上,單點硬體故障可自動遷移,保障業務連續性。此外,雲伺服器遵循按需付費模式,避免了巨大的前期資本投入,降低了總體擁有成本。
如何科學選購雲伺服器
選購雲伺服器並非簡單地選擇最貴的配置,而是一個需要綜合評估業務需求、技術特性和成本的過程。錯誤的選型可能導致資源浪費或效能瓶頸。
明確業務需求與技術指標
首先,需要清晰定義應用場景。是執行高流量網站、處理大資料分析、還是作為開發測試環境?這直接決定了核心配置的選擇方向。重點關注以下幾個技術指標:CPU核心數與主頻,它決定了計算處理能力;記憶體大小,影響應用併發處理和資料快取;儲存型別與容量,包括高效能SSD和大容量HDD,以及是否需掛載獨立雲硬碟;網路頻寬,涉及公網入出頻寬、內網頻寬及流量計費模式。
選擇雲服務提供商與地域節點
市場上有眾多雲服務商,選擇時需綜合考慮其品牌信譽、技術穩定性、產品生態豐富度、售後服務與文件支援。此外,伺服器地域的選擇至關重要,應優先選擇離目標使用者群體最近的地域節點,以最大程度降低網路延遲,提升訪問速度。同時,需留意不同地域提供的例項型別和價格可能存在差異。
雲伺服器的部署與初始化配置
成功購買雲伺服器後,合理的初始配置是穩定執行的起點。這一階段的工作將為後續所有應用部署打下堅實基礎。
推薦閱讀 雲伺服器選擇指南:從零開始,如何挑選最適合你的雲端方案。
作業系統的選擇與安全加固
根據應用技術棧選擇合適的作業系統映象,常見的有各發行版Linux(如CentOS、Ubuntu)和Windows Server。系統初始化後,首要任務是進行安全加固:立即修改預設的root或Administrator密碼;建立具有sudo許可權的普通使用者,並考慮禁用root直接登入;配置防火牆規則,僅開放必要的服務埠;設定SSH金鑰對認證,替代密碼登入以增強安全性。
基礎執行環境與網路配置
安裝應用所依賴的軟體環境,如Web伺服器、資料庫、執行時環境等。配置伺服器的網路環境,包括設定主機名、配置靜態IP、最佳化核心網路引數以提升連線效能。對於生產環境,建議將伺服器置於私有網路內,並透過負載均衡器或NAT閘道器對外提供服務,以增強網路安全性。
雲伺服器的日常運維與監控
運維是確保雲伺服器長期穩定、高效、安全執行的關鍵。建立系統化的運維流程和監控體系,能夠實現從被動救火到主動預防的轉變。
系統監控與效能最佳化
利用雲服務商提供的監控服務或自建監控系統,對伺服器的CPU使用率、記憶體佔用、磁碟I/O、網路流量等關鍵指標進行持續追蹤。設定合理的告警閾值,以便在出現異常時及時收到通知。定期分析監控資料,識別效能瓶頸,例如透過最佳化資料庫索引、調整Web伺服器併發引數、升級配置或進行應用架構最佳化來解決。
資料備份與容災策略
資料是核心資產,必須建立可靠的備份機制。制定備份策略,包括全量備份和增量備份的頻率,並確保備份檔案儲存在不同的地域或儲存型別上,以實現異地容災。定期進行備份恢復演練,驗證備份資料的有效性和恢復流程的可行性。對於關鍵業務,應設計高可用架構,例如使用多臺雲伺服器組成叢集,並結合負載均衡和自動伸縮組,以應對單點故障和流量高峰。
安全運維與成本管理
安全運維需常態化:定期更新作業系統和應用軟體的安全補丁;使用日誌分析工具審計系統日誌和安全日誌,排查可疑活動;定期進行安全漏洞掃描和滲透測試。在成本管理方面,定期審查資源使用情況,關閉或釋放閒置的雲伺服器和磁碟,根據實際負載調整例項規格,或考慮使用預留例項券等節省計劃來最佳化長期執行成本。
推薦閱讀 雲伺服器終極指南:從入門到精通,全面解析選購、部署與最佳化策略。
總結
雲伺服器的管理是一個涵蓋技術、流程和策略的綜合性課題。從初期的精準選購,匹配業務需求與資源配置,到中期的安全部署與初始化加固,再到後期的持續監控、效能最佳化、備份容災與成本控制,每一個環節都不可或缺。掌握這套從選購到運維的完整方法論,不僅能確保業務系統在雲上穩定、高效、安全地執行,更能實現技術投入與業務價值的最優平衡,真正釋放雲計算帶來的強大動能。
FAQ 常見問題
雲伺服器和虛擬主機有什麼區別?
雲伺服器提供的是完整的、獨立的虛擬機器例項,使用者擁有完整的root或管理員許可權,可以自由安裝任何軟體和進行系統級配置,資源獨享且可彈性伸縮。虛擬主機通常是在一臺伺服器上透過技術劃分出的多個網站空間,使用者只能管理網站檔案,無法控制系統環境,資源共享且配置固定。
如何判斷我的應用需要多少配置?
建議從實際測試出發。初期可以選用滿足最低執行要求的配置進行部署,並密切監控CPU、記憶體、磁碟和網路的使用率。當資源使用率持續超過70%時,應考慮升級配置。同時,利用雲伺服器的彈性,可以在預期的大流量活動前臨時提升配置,活動結束後再降回。
雲伺服器的資料安全如何保障?
資料安全需要使用者與雲服務商共同負責。雲服務商負責底層基礎設施的安全,如物理資料中心安全、硬體可靠性和虛擬化隔離。使用者則需負責作業系統及以上層面的安全,包括系統漏洞修補、防火牆配置、訪問控制、資料加密以及定期備份。重要資料務必實施多副本、跨地域備份策略。
遇到伺服器被攻擊或中病毒該怎麼辦?
首先,應立即隔離問題伺服器,例如透過修改安全組規則切斷其公網訪問,防止影響擴大。然後,透過雲控制檯VNC等方式登入伺服器,排查異常程序、網路連線和檔案。清除惡意程式,修復安全漏洞。如果系統已被嚴重破壞,最穩妥的方式是從最近的乾淨備份恢復資料到一個新建的伺服器上,並完成全面的安全加固後重新上線。事後必須分析攻擊路徑,完善安全策略。
下一步,接下來該怎麼做?
延伸閱讀與實用知識
下面這些內容與本文主題相關,適合繼續深入閱讀。優先從與你當前問題最接近的文章開始看,再逐步擴充套件到周邊主題,效果通常會更好。